		<description>We use Swheat Scoup at our house, and keep the litter box right next to the toilet.  LOVE it because of the same reasons you posted above: no chemicals, it’s flushable and it doesn&#039;t smell.  I mean, it doesn&#039;t smell like gross perfumey kitty litter AND it doesn&#039;t smell like kitty pee.  This stuff is great.  The only time I ever get an odor out of that box is when someone forgets to &quot;cover up her work&quot; in there, if you know what I mean.  And that&#039;s saying something with three cats!  
One thing that is recommended by Swheat Scoup is to &quot;pretreat&quot; your litter box before you pour the fresh litter into it.  They suggest spraying the sides and bottom with non stick cooking spray.  Which seems really odd, but holy heck, does it work!!  No more scraping clumps suck to the bottom!  And you can even get organic spray, so again, no harmful chemicals for Kitty.
Also, I used this litter when I was fostering kittens.  When kittens are starting to use the litter box you don’t&#039; want to use a clumping litter.  The thought is that if they ingest it while they are exploring, it could clump in their little tummies and create a dangerous obstruction.  This litter is essentially food, so I didn’t have worry about it!</description>
